Frequently Asked Questions about North Lincoln
What type of rentals are currently available in North Lincoln?
There are currently 171 Apartments for Rent in North Lincoln, NE with pricing that ranges from $425 to $2,400. There are also 30 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in North Lincoln ranging from $795 to $2,550.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in North Lincoln?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in North Lincoln ranges from $795 to $2,550 with an average monthly rent of $1,715.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in North Lincoln?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in North Lincoln range from $1,370 to $2,342,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,375 to $2,550.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,750 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,499.
